Express is a web application framework for Node.js, released as free and open-source software under the MIT License. It is designed for building web applications and APIs.
Google Maps is a web mapping service. It offers satellite imagery, aerial photography, street maps, 360° interactive panoramic views of streets, real-time traffic conditions, and route planning for traveling by foot, car, bicycle and air, or public transportation.
Google Pay is a digital wallet platform and online payment system developed by Google to power in-app and tap-to-pay purchases on mobile devices, enabling users to make payments with Android phones, tablets or watches.
Nginx is a web server that can also be used as a reverse proxy, load balancer, mail proxy and HTTP cache.
Stenciljs is an open-source web component compiler that enables developers to create reusable, interoperable UI components that can work across different frameworks and platforms.
Stripe offers online payment processing for internet businesses as well as fraud prevention, invoicing and subscription management.
Swiper is a JavaScript library that creates modern touch sliders with hardware-accelerated transitions.
